Asus continues to reinvent the landscape of motherboard technology, most notably with their new ROG Crosshair X870E Apex, which promises unmatched performance for extreme overclockers. Set for release on April 4th at a price point of $749, this board made its grand entrance at CES, garnering notable attention for its design tailored to push CPU and memory limits to new heights. Remarkably, this is the first ROG Apex motherboard specifically crafted for AMD Ryzen processors. Built around the AMD X870E chipset, the X870E Apex comes compatible with Ryzen 7000, 8000, and 9000 series processors, solidifying its place among elite motherboards. Central to this offering is the inclusion of USB 4.0 ports, a key feature distinguishing it from its predecessor, the X670E chipset.

High-End Design and Memory Capabilities

One of the standout features of the Asus ROG Crosshair X870E Apex is undoubtedly its layout for optimal memory overclocking. Sporting a one DIMM Per Channel (DPC) configuration, this motherboard is ready to handle extreme overclocking tasks with memory transfer rates reaching up to an impressive 9600 MT/s, specifically for the Ryzen 8000 series. The five M.2 slots provided (three PCIe 5.0 and two PCIe 4.0) ensure ample storage, supplemented by four SATA ports for additional capacity. Adding to its versatile appeal are two PCIe 5.0 x16 slots featuring Asus’s Q-Release Slim for seamless component handling, offering enhanced connectivity and expansion options.

Beyond sheer performance, Asus has designed the X870E Apex with a suite of connectivity options to accommodate a range of peripherals and additional devices. The rear I/O panel is particularly rich, featuring two USB 4.0 Type-C ports, six 10 Gbps USB ports, and two 5 Gbps USB ports. Essential features such as Wi-Fi 7, Bluetooth 5.4, and wired internet via an Ethernet port underscore its modern connectivity strengths. Overclocking enthusiasts will also appreciate additional functionalities including a PS/2 connector, comprehensive audio jacks, an S/PDIF out port, BIOS FlashBack, and a clear CMOS button. The front panel offers a USB 20 Gbps Type-C port with 60W PD/QC4+ and a USB-C connector supporting PPS, perfect for devices like Samsung Galaxy phones.

Robust Power Delivery System and Overclocking Features

The Asus ROG Crosshair X870E Apex does not fall short in its power delivery system, which is a crucial aspect for any high-performance motherboard. It boasts eighteen 110A power stages, two 110A stages, and two 80A stages, ensuring a steady and reliable power supply. High-quality components such as MicroFine alloy chokes and capacitors further enhance its efficiency and durability. These features collectively ensure that overclockers have the power and stability they need to push their components to the limit.

In addition to the first-rate hardware, Asus has integrated powerful overclocking software tools to complement the X870E Apex’s capabilities. Tools like Dynamic OC Switcher, Core Flex, and Asynchronous clock provide users with precise control over their systems, allowing for fine-tuned performance adjustments. These features are particularly beneficial for those who demand the utmost from their setups, offering both flexibility and precision. The X870E Apex’s design and software integration reflect Asus’s commitment to providing users with a comprehensive toolset for achieving optimal performance.
